Castello di Ripa d'Orcia is situated in Tuscany's Val d'Orcia, in a landscape considered to be one of the most beautiful in the whole region. Within the old castle wall a number of apartments have been created where to experience the unique atmosphere of an ancient country residence.

Earliest recorded mention of Castello di Ripa d'Orcia dates back to the XIII century. From 1274, in fact, the castle belonged to the noble Salimbeni family, when together with a series of small settlements in the area it formed the small independent state of Consorteria. From 1484 the castle, fortified hamlet, and the surrounding settlements, passed to the Carli branch of the Piccolomini family.

Towards the end of the 19th century, Count Pietro Piccolomini Clementini commissioned important restoration work which succeeded in bringing the castle back to its original splendour. The ancient dwellings distributed along two parallel roads, the Church of S.Maria delle Nevi, the gardens and vegetable plots, are all protected within the ancient stone walls which encircle the castle hamlet. A high tower rises up from the building which once housed the cellars, banqueting hall, and weapons room. From the top of the periphery wall stunning views of the Tentannano fort and the hillside precipitating steeply down to the banks of Orcia river can be admired.

Today the Castello di Ripa d'Orcia has been transformed in exclusive historic residence with a number of luxurious rooms and apartments reserved for guests. The apartments, with living room, open fireplace, and fully equipped kitchen, are particularly suitable for those wishing to self cater.

Superb traditional Tuscan cuisine is served to guests dining at the Ristoro di Ripa d'Orcia, a restaurant where to enjoy simple, yet flavour packed dishes, prepared using ingredients produced on the castle farm. The old cellar provides a charming venue for tastings of the estate's olive oil, wine, and other typical Tuscan fare. The pathways through the Ripa d'Orcia Park surrounding the castle lead visitors in to an enchanting and unmistakably Tuscan landscape.
